On 9/24/21 13:53, Richard Sandiford wrote:
> This patch adds a lang hook for defining a struct/RECORD_TYPE
> “as if” it had appeared directly in the source code. It follows
> the similar existing hook for enums.
>
> It's the caller's responsibility to create the fields
> (as FIELD_DECLs) but the hook's responsibility to create
> and declare the associated RECORD_TYPE.
>
> For now the hook is hard-coded to do the equivalent of:
>
> typedef struct NAME { FIELDS } NAME;
>
> but this could be controlled by an extra parameter if some callers
> want a different behaviour in future.
>
> The motivating use case is to allow the long list of struct
> definitions in arm_neon.h to be provided by the compiler,
> which in turn unblocks various arm_neon.h optimisations.
>
> Tested on aarch64-linux-gnu, individually and with a follow-on
> patch from Jonathan that makes use of the hook. OK to install?

Why fall back to the language-independent function on error? Is there a
case where that gives better error recovery than just returning
error_mark_node?

Setting TYPE_NAME and TYPE_STUB_DECL to the typedef is wrong; it should
work to just remove these two lines. I expect they're also wrong for C.
For C++ only, I wonder if you need this typedef at all.
If you do want it, you need to use set_underlying_type to create a real
typedef. I expect that's also true for C.
